Charlotte Flair and Bianca Belair are set to team for a big tag team match on the August 18 edition of WWE SmackDown.
At WWE SummerSlam, Bianca Belair defeated Asuka and Charlotte Flair to win the WWE Women’s Championship. However, IYO SKY went on to successfully cash in her Money In The Bank contract to beat Belair to win the title.
On the August 11 edition of SmackDown, Damage CTRL’s SKY and Bayley interfered in the Asuka vs. Charlotte Flair match to cause a no contest after attacking both women.
On Friday afternoon, WWE announced that Damage CTRL will team up to face Charlotte Flair and Bianca Belair on the August 18 episode of SmackDown from Toronto.
This should be intriguing as the past times Belair and Flair teamed up with one another, they didn’t quite get along too well.
Meanwhile, both women will be trying to put themselves in line for the first crack at IYO SKY’s WWE Women’s Championship.
Also worth remembering, Bayley will have to have eyes in the back of her head after Shotzi has been stalking her over the past few weeks.
Also announced for tonight’s show, Edge will celebrate his 25th anniversary by facing Sheamus for the first time ever and the fallout to Jey Uso “quitting” WWE at the end of last week’s show.
